Autonomous Vehicle Security refers to the measures and technologies designed to protect self-driving cars from cyber threats, ensuring safe operation and passenger safety. This encompasses advanced software protection, intrusion detection systems, and secure communication protocols, addressing vulnerabilities that arise from the integration of vehicles with complex electronics and connectivity features. The significance of the Autonomous Vehicle Security market lies in its role in fostering consumer trust, regulatory compliance, and the overall viability of autonomous vehicle technology as it becomes more mainstream.

The Autonomous Vehicle Security Market encompasses various types of security measures essential for protecting self-driving vehicles.
- Application Security focuses on safeguarding software applications from vulnerabilities and attacks.
- Network Security secures communication between vehicles and infrastructure, preventing unauthorized access.
- Wireless Security protects against threats in wireless communication, such as hacking.
- Cloud Security ensures data stored in cloud services is safe from breaches and theft.
- Others includes additional measures like endpoint security and compliance with regulations, addressing diverse security needs in autonomous vehicles.

The Autonomous Vehicle Security Market encompasses various applications to ensure safe and reliable operation. Identity Access Management secures user identities and vehicle access. Unified Threat Management consolidates security processes, while IDS/IPS detect and respond to cyber threats. Risk & Vulnerability Management identifies and mitigates potential security weaknesses. DDoS Mitigation protects against distributed denial-of-service attacks. Anti-Malware safeguards vehicles from malicious software. Data Loss Prevention ensures sensitive data is not compromised. Collectively, these solutions enhance the cybersecurity framework for autonomous vehicles.
Key Drivers and Barriers in the Autonomous Vehicle Security Market
The Autonomous Vehicle Security Market is driven by rising demand for enhanced safety features, increasing cyber threats, and regulatory pressures for secure transportation systems. Innovative solutions include advanced encryption, AI-driven threat detection, and blockchain for secure vehicle-to-vehicle communication. Challenges such as complex software ecosystems and the high cost of implementation can be mitigated through cross-industry collaborations and standardization of security protocols. Moreover, continuous advancements in machine learning and real-time monitoring can proactively address vulnerabilities, ensuring safer autonomous driving environments. Emphasizing user awareness and education also plays a crucial role in fostering trust and acceptance of autonomous technologies.
